What Is Gear Coupling
A gear coupling is a mechanical device used to connect two rotating shafts for transmitting torque while allowing for misalignment. It consists of two hubs with external gear teeth and a sleeve with internal teeth that mesh together. This design enables the coupling to handle angular, parallel, and axial misalignment efficiently.
Gear couplings are commonly used in applications where high torque transmission is required, such as steel plants, cement industries, power plants, and heavy machinery. Compared to conventional shaft coupling solutions, gear couplings offer superior load capacity, compact size, and extended operational life.
Industries prefer gear coupling for heavy machinery because it ensures smooth power transmission even under challenging operating conditions like vibration, shock loads, and fluctuating speeds.
Classification of Gear Coupling
Gear couplings can be classified based on design, flexibility, and application requirements. Understanding these classifications helps industries choose the right coupling for their machinery.
1. Rigid Gear Coupling
Rigid gear couplings are designed for applications where precise shaft alignment is possible. They offer excellent torque transmission but limited flexibility.
2. Flexible Gear Coupling
Flexible couplings allow controlled misalignment between shafts, reducing stress on connected components. These are widely used in industrial machinery where minor misalignment is unavoidable.
3. Full Gear Coupling
This type consists of two hubs and a single sleeve. Full gear couplings are ideal for high-speed and high-torque applications.
4. Half Gear Coupling
Half gear couplings are typically used where one shaft is supported by a bearing or gearbox. They provide flexibility while maintaining torque efficiency.
Each classification is engineered to meet specific performance needs, ensuring operational reliability across industries.
Types of Gear Coupling
There are several types of gear coupling, each suited for different industrial applications:
1. Single Engagement Gear Coupling
Designed for limited shaft misalignment, these couplings are commonly used in light to medium-duty machinery.
2. Double Engagement Gear Coupling
Double engagement gear coupling allows greater flexibility and higher torque transmission, making it ideal for heavy machinery and industrial drives.
3. Continuous Sleeve Gear Coupling
This type offers enhanced strength and durability, suitable for high-speed operations and continuous-duty applications.
4. Floating Shaft Gear Coupling
Used where large distances exist between driving and driven shafts, floating shaft couplings are widely used in steel mills and rolling plants.
Each gear coupling type is manufactured with precision to ensure optimal performance, reduced maintenance, and longer service life.
